Throat Coil & Mirror Maintenance
The 17 T throat coils and expander region are maintained to preserve the field profile that feeds the direct converter.
The throat coils (17 T) sit at the transition between the central cell and the expander, shaping the diverging field that carries the plasma stream to the direct converter. Their maintenance preserves the field profile and the mechanical integrity of the expander region, which is central to conversion performance.

Expander region
Downstream of the throat, the expander tank and the diverging field region are inspected for surface condition and alignment, because the geometry sets how cleanly the plasma stream reaches the collector. Any drift in field profile or geometry affects how efficiently energy is captured.
Coordination with the DEC end
Throat and expander maintenance is coordinated with direct-converter servicing, since they form one continuous path from central cell to collector. Access and remote-handling provisions are designed so the region can be inspected without a full machine disassembly.
